A place for environmental refugees: Adaptation to climate and environmental change in South Asia

Abstract/Summary:
This thesis investigates climate-related environmental change as a distinct threat to the low-lying coastal zones of South Asia, particularly among vulnerable populations in Bangladesh and Maldives. With the objective of identifying adaptive strategies against erosion and inundation in low-lying coastal zones, the thesis examines planned relocation as an adaptive to response to climate-related environmental threats.
